How this record is calculated

This page reflects every publicly posted pick from @tonestakes that declared a side, line where applicable, odds taken, and unit stake. Picks without those details are not gradeable and are not shown. Moneylines without posted odds are graded at the Pinnacle price from when they posted; spreads and totals default to -110. Player props without odds count toward win rate but not units profit.
